The lot consisted of the following coins: 1 centesimo and 2 centesimi (both 1867 Milan mint), 10 centesimi 1862 Paris mint, 1 lira 1863 Milan mint, 2 lire 1863 Naples mint and the big 5 lire (1875, Milan mint). Nothing special or scarce... junk silver and a couple of copper coins. BUT...

The last coin, an 1861 5 centesimi, bears the 'B' mintmark... Bologna mint... that's awesome, since I only payed 55 euro for the lot, while that coin alone sold for about 60/70 euro in this grade.
No high grade at all, but a pleasant coin. I like it. It's my first and last Bologna mint coin, since this atelier was closed after 1861 and only produced this con for the Kingdom of Italy.
